In addition to the usual pair of 5 1/4" floppy drives, I have two 
Remex 4000 8" disk drives attached to my Zenith Z-100, and I'd sure
like to learn just what the various little jumper-selectable options
on the drive boards do.

All of the drives work, but with one little "hitch" that bugs me.
Reading a Shugart manual for similar drives (unfortunately, I don't
have Shugart drives), makes me suspect one of the jumpers will un-bug me.

The "hitch" is that when I boot, my system doesn't recognize the
presence of either 8" drive UNLESS the drive door is closed (whether
or not a diskette is inside).  The Shugart 850 manual manual lists
an option to "select drive and enable stepper without loading heads",
which would (probably) permit my system to step to track 00 and
verify that the drive is actually present.

Does anyone know anything about the Remex jumpers (or other options)?

             REMEX 4000/4001 8" DS FLOPPY DISK DRIVE
               Customer Cut/Add Trace Options
 
 
  Trace                                            Shipped from Factory
Designation           Description                     Open    Short
  7A         Termination for Multiplexed Inputs               Plugged
  DS1        Drive Select 1 Input Pin                            X
DS2,3,4      Drive Select 2,3,4 Input Pins              X
1B,2B,3B,4B  Side Select Option Using Drive Select      X
  RR         Radial Ready                                        X
  RI         Radial Index and Sector                             X
R (Shunt 5E) Option Shunt for Ready Output                       X
  2S         Two-Sided Status Output                    X
4000/4001    Sector Option Enable                     4000     4001
I (Shunt 5E) Index Output                                        X
S (Shunt 5E) Sector Output                                       X
  DC         Disk Change Option                         X
HL (Shunt 5E) Stepper Power from Head Load                       X
  DS         Stepper Power from Drive Select            X
  WP         Inhibit Write When Write Protected                  X
  NP         Allow Write When Write Protected           X
  D          Alternate Input - In Use                   X
  DL         Door Lock Option                                    X
A,B,X (5E)   Radial Head Load                                    X
  C          Alternate Input - Head Load                X
Z (Shunt 5E) In Use from Drive Select                            X
  Y          In Use from Head Load                      X
  S1         Side Select Option Using Drive Select      X
  S2         Standard Side Select Option                         X
  S3         Side Select Optioon Using Drive Select     X
  TS,FS      Data Separation Option Select              FS       TS
               TS - True Separation
               FS - False Separation
                  (The Data Separation goes out of
                   phase in the IBM Address Mark Fields)
-5V, -15V    -5 Volt Supply Option                               X
U4,U6,U8,U   Unselect Ready                             X
AA,BB,CC     Disk Change Output                                BB to CC
 
Shunt 5E is a 16 pin programmable shunt at location 5E on the circuit
board.
